Mastering utility usage in CS2 is essential for taking your gameplay to the next level. Understanding when to deploy grenades and equipment can greatly influence the outcome of a round. For instance, using a smoke grenade to block enemy snipers at the start of a round can create safer pathways for your team. Additionally, timing your flashes to coincide with teammates' engagements can maximize their effectiveness, blind opponents just as your team pushes. To streamline your utility usage, consider adhering to a structured plan, such as utilizing utility round strategies that dictate when and where to use specific tools throughout the game.
Another fundamental aspect to consider in CS2 is the timing of your utility based on the round's economy and the enemies' strategies. During buy rounds, you can afford to spend more on utilities, while saving them for crucial moments such as executing a bomb site push. It's beneficial to maintain an awareness of enemy positions and potential movements, allowing you to time your molotovs and flashes effectively, disrupting their plans when they least expect it. By learning the rhythms of the game and adapting your utility timing accordingly, you'll not only elevate your personal gameplay but also enhance your team's overall performance in CS2.

Timing your CS2 utility is crucial for gaining a tactical advantage in any match. One common mistake players make is using utilities too early or too late during engagements. For instance, deploying smokes or flashes before pushing can lead to missed opportunities if the enemy is not yet set up. Conversely, using them too late can result in wasted potential and unnecessary casualties. To fix this, always assess the game situation and communicate with your team to ensure that utilities are deployed at the opportune moment for maximum effect.
Another typical error is forgetting to account for your team's positioning when tossing utilities. Many players throw grenades without considering their teammates' locations, leading to friendly fire and ineffective usage. A better strategy involves practicing utility timing with your team during scrims or practice sessions. Regularly discuss effective ways to utilize grenades based on your team's playstyle. By correcting these common mistakes, you can significantly enhance your team's performance and effectiveness in CS2.
